A DAUNIAN POTTERY STRAINER ASKOS
CIRCA 4TH CENTURY B.C.
The spherical body with two vertical spouts, one fitted with a concave strainer, a conjoined rib handle between, the body decorated in brown slip with parallel bands of linked chain, vines, wave patterns and other decorative elements, some details in added red
10 5/8 in. (27 cm.) high
Provenance
M.H. Bloxam, by whom given to Rugby School Art Museum.
